That's real strange - I should try your detection code, it looks like it should work. Yeah, the Zire 21 simulator does a poor job here.

BTW, I discovered that you can debug directly on the Zire 21, so that might give you some help (It helped me discover an obscure problem relating to bitmap families and the upgrade to the new version of Constructor included in the Palm OS 5.3 SDK upgrade - too complicated to describe here, but just opening and saving the resource files with the new Constructor before trying code on a Zire 21 is a very good idea...)

>> The Simulator really isn't a Zire 21 simulator - they made some cosmetic
>> changes, but it's not really good enough (for the most part you can say
>> this about all the Simulators that palmOne has released...).  It reports
>> that the Zire 21 has the sound manager, which is not the case on the real
>> device (remember, the Zire 21 simulator also comes up in color, also).
>>
>> As to hangs on the device, I don't know why you're getting it.  Are you
>> trying to play streamed sound even if the sound manager isn't present?  I
>> mean the code I had only checks for features.  If you're trying to stream
>> sound when you don't have a sound manager who knows what will happen.
>
>No, the problem is with my original sound manager detection code, which was
>slightly different that yours, detected a sound manager on the Zire 21.  I've
>since changed my code and have yet to test it on an actual device.  It just
>turns out that the simulator with the sound disable still detects the sound
>manager.  Hopefully the code will work on the real device.
